ABSTRACT

Very rare tumors are usually divided into two groups: One includes tumors that are rare among both children and adults; the other one encompasses tumors that frequently occur in adults but are rarely observed in children. In this review, we focus on adrenocortical tumors, neuroendocrine tumors of the appendix, pheochromocytoma and paraganglioma, pancreatoblastoma and solid pseudopapillary tumors of the pancreas, with special attention to the role of surgery as main curative intervention or as part of the multimodal treatment.

ABSTRACT

Nuclear protein of the testis carcinoma is an exceedingly rare and poorly differentiated carcinoma characterized by BDR4::NUTM1 gene translocation. Typically, the tumor affects young adults, and no standardized recommendations for therapeutic management have been available since 2022; the clinical course remains mostly dismal. We report the successful multimodal treatment of a 13-year-old boy affected by a primary chest NUT-carcinoma with a novel NUTM1 rearrangement that remains in complete continuous remission at 30 months from diagnosis.

ABSTRACT

INTRODUCTION: Over the years, congenital lung malformations (CLM) management remains a controversial topic in pediatric thoracic surgery. The Italian Society of Pediatric Surgery performed a national survey to study the current management variability among centers, trying to define national guidelines and a standardized approach of children with congenital lung malformations. METHODS: Following a National Society approval, an electronic survey including 35 items on post-natal management was designed, focusing on surgical, anesthesiology, radiology and pneumology aspects. The survey was conducted contacting all pediatric surgical units performing thoracic surgery. RESULTS: 39 pediatric surgery units (97.5%) participated in the study. 13 centers (33.3%) were classified as high-volume (Group A), while 26 centers (66.7%) were low volume (Group B). Variances in diagnostic imaging protocols were observed, with Group A performing fewer CT scans compared to Group B (p = 0.012). Surgical indications favored operative approaches for asymptomatic CLM and pulmonary sequestrations in both groups, while a wait-and-see approach was common for congenital lobar emphysema. Surgical timing for asymptomatic CLM differed significantly, with most high-volume centers operating on patients younger than 12 months (p = 0.02). Thoracoscopy was the preferred approach for asymptomatic CLM in most of centers, while postoperative long-term follow-up was not performed in most of the centers. CONCLUSION: Thoracoscopic approach seems uniform in asymptomatic CLM patients and variable in symptomatic children. Lack of uniformity in surgical timing and preoperative imaging assessment has been identified as key areas to establish a common national pattern of care for CLM.

ABSTRACT

The treatment of extremity rhabdomyosarcoma remains a challenge due to several adverse prognostic factors frequently associated with this tumor site. The International Soft-Tissue Sarcoma Database Consortium (INSTRuCT) is a collaboration of the Children's Oncology Group Soft-Tissue Sarcoma Committee, the European Pediatric Soft-Tissue Sarcoma Study Group, and the Cooperative Weichteilsarkom Studiengruppe. The INSTRuCT surgical committee developed an internationally applicable consensus opinion document for the surgical treatment of extremity rhabdomyosarcoma. This document addresses surgical management, including biopsy, nodal staging, timing of therapy, resection and reexcision, reconstruction, and surgical approach at relapse.

ABSTRACT

OBJECTIVE: To create the first structured surgical report form for NBL with international consensus, to permit standardized documentation of all NBL-related surgical procedures and their outcomes. SUMMARY OF BACKGROUND DATA: NBL, the most common extracranial solid malignant tumor in children, covers a wide spectrum of tumors with significant differences in anatomical localization, organ or vessel involvement, and tumor biology. Complete surgical resection of the primary tumor is an important part of NBL treatment, but maybe hazardous, prone to complications and its role in high-risk disease remains debated. Various surgical guidelines exist within the protocols of the different cooperative groups, although there is no standardized operative report form to document the surgical treatment of NBL. METHODS: After analyzing the treatment protocols of the SIOP Europe International Neuroblastoma Study Group, Children's Oncology Group, and Gesellschaft fuer Paediatrische Onkologie und Haematologie - German Association of Pediatric Oncology and Haematology pediatric cooperative groups, important variables were defined to completely describe surgical biopsy and resection of NBL and their outcomes. All variables were discussed within the Surgical Committees of SIOP Europe International Neuroblastoma Study Group, Children's Oncology Group, and Gesellschaft fuer Paediatrische Onkologie und Haematologie - German Association of Pediatric Oncology and Haematology. Thereafter, joint meetings were organized to obtain intercontinental consensus. RESULTS: The "International Neuroblastoma Surgical Report Form" provides a structured reporting tool for all NBL surgery, in every anatomical region, documenting all Image Defined Risk Factors and structures involved, with obligatory reporting of intraoperative and 30 day-postoperative complications. CONCLUSION: The International Neuroblastoma Surgical Report Form is the first universal form for the structured and uniform reporting of NBL-related surgical procedures and their outcomes, aiming to facilitate the postoperative communication, treatment planning and analysis of surgical treatment of NBL.

ABSTRACT

Congenital anomalies of the liver, biliary tree and pancreas are rare birth defects, some of which are characterized by a marked variation in geographical incidence. Morphogenesis of the hepatobiliary and pancreatic structures initiates from two tubular endodermal evaginations of the most distal portion of the foregut. The pancreas develops from a larger dorsal and a smaller ventral outpouching; emergence of the two buds will eventually lead to the fusion of the duct system. A small part of the remaining ventral diverticulum divides into a "pars cystica" and "pars hepatica", giving rise to the cystic duct and gallbladder and the liver lobes, respectively. Disruption or malfunctioning of the complex mechanisms leading to the development of liver, gallbladder, biliary tree and pancreas can result in numerous, albeit fortunately relatively rare, congenital anomalies in these organs. The type and severity of anomalies often depend on the exact moment in which disruption or alteration of the embryological mechanisms takes place. Many theories have been brought forward to explain their embryological basis; however, no agreement has yet been reached for most of them. While in some cases pathological evaluation might be more centered on macroscopic evaluation, in other instances small biopsies will be the keystone to understanding organ function and treatment results in the context of congenital anomalies. Thus, knowledge of the existence and histopathological characteristics of some of the more common conditions is mandatory for every pathologist working in the field of gastrointestinal pathology.

ABSTRACT

Congenital anomalies of the tubular gastrointestinal tract are an important cause of morbidity not only in infants, but also in children and adults.The gastrointestinal (GI) tract, composed of all three primitive germ layers, develops early during embryogenesis. Two major steps in its development are the formation of the gut tube (giving rise to the foregut, the midgut and the hindgut), and the formation of individual organs with specialized cell types.Formation of an intact and functioning GI tract is under strict control from various molecular pathways. Disruption of any of these crucial mechanisms involved in the cell-fate decision along the dorsoventral, anteroposterior, left-right and radial axes, can lead to numerous congenital anomalies, most of which occur and present in infancy. However, they may run undetected during childhood.Therapy is surgical, which in some cases must be performed urgently, and prognosis depends on early diagnosis and suitable treatment.A precise pathologic macroscopic or microscopic diagnosis is important, not only for the immediate treatment and management of affected individuals, but also for future counselling of the affected individual and their family. This is even more true in cases of multiple anomalies or syndromic patterns.We discuss some of the more frequent or clinically important congenital anomalies of the tubular GI, including atresia's, duplications, intestinal malrotation, Meckel's diverticulum and Hirschsprung's Disease.

ABSTRACT

BACKGROUND: Cisplatin chemotherapy and surgery are effective treatments for children with standard-risk hepatoblastoma but may cause considerable and irreversible hearing loss. This trial compared cisplatin with cisplatin plus delayed administration of sodium thiosulfate, aiming to reduce the incidence and severity of cisplatin-related ototoxic effects without jeopardizing overall and event-free survival. METHODS: We randomly assigned children older than 1 month and younger than 18 years of age who had standard-risk hepatoblastoma (≤3 involved liver sectors, no metastatic disease, and an alpha-fetoprotein level of >100 ng per milliliter) to receive cisplatin alone (at a dose of 80 mg per square meter of body-surface area, administered over a period of 6 hours) or cisplatin plus sodium thiosulfate (at a dose of 20 g per square meter, administered intravenously over a 15-minute period, 6 hours after the discontinuation of cisplatin) for four preoperative and two postoperative courses. The primary end point was the absolute hearing threshold, as measured by pure-tone audiometry, at a minimum age of 3.5 years. Hearing loss was assessed according to the Brock grade (on a scale from 0 to 4, with higher grades indicating greater hearing loss). The main secondary end points were overall survival and event-free survival at 3 years. RESULTS: A total of 109 children were randomly assigned to receive cisplatin plus sodium thiosulfate (57 children) or cisplatin alone (52) and could be evaluated. Sodium thiosulfate was associated with few high-grade toxic effects. The absolute hearing threshold was assessed in 101 children. Hearing loss of grade 1 or higher occurred in 18 of 55 children (33%) in the cisplatin-sodium thiosulfate group, as compared with 29 of 46 (63%) in the cisplatin-alone group, indicating a 48% lower incidence of hearing loss in the cisplatin-sodium thiosulfate group (relative risk, 0.52; 95% confidence interval [CI], 0.33 to 0.81; P=0.002). At a median of 52 months of follow-up, the 3-year rates of event-free survival were 82% (95% CI, 69 to 90) in the cisplatin-sodium thiosulfate group and 79% (95% CI, 65 to 88) in the cisplatin-alone group, and the 3-year rates of overall survival were 98% (95% CI, 88 to 100) and 92% (95% CI, 81 to 97), respectively. CONCLUSIONS: The addition of sodium thiosulfate, administered 6 hours after cisplatin chemotherapy, resulted in a lower incidence of cisplatin-induced hearing loss among children with standard-risk hepatoblastoma, without jeopardizing overall or event-free survival. ABSTRACT

Pediatric adrenocortical tumors (ACT) are rare and sometimes aggressive malignancies, but there is no consensus on the outcome predictors in children. A systematic search of MEDLINE, SCOPUS, Web of Science, and the Cochrane Library for studies from 1994 to 2020 about pediatric ACT was performed. In 42 studies, 1006 patients, aged 0-18 years, were included. The meta-analyses resulted in the following predictors of better outcome: age <4 years (P < .00001), nonsecreting tumors (P = .004), complete surgical resection (P < .00001), tumor volume (P < .0001), tumor weight (P < .00001), tumor maximum diameter (P = .0009), and Stage I disease (P < .00001). Moreover, patients affected by Cushing syndrome showed a worse outcome (P < .0001). International prospective studies should be implemented to standardize clinical prognostic factors evaluation, together with pathological scores, in the stratification of pediatric ACT.

ABSTRACT

BACKGROUND: Extra-appendicular neuroendocrine tumors (NETs) are very rare tumors. While diagnostic and therapeutic guidelines are well established for adults, data on children and adolescents are lacking. PATIENTS AND METHODS: Patients with a diagnosis of extra-appendicular NET registered on the Tumori Rari in Età Pediatrica - Rare Tumors in Pediatric Age (TREP) from 2000 to 2020 were analyzed. Clinical characteristics including patients' presentation, tumor features, treatment, and outcome were reviewed. RESULTS: Twenty-seven patients with extra-appendicular NET registered on TREP with a median age of 173 months. The primary site was the pancreas (12) or bronchi (10) in the majority of cases. Other primary sites included the thymus, Meckel's diverticulum, and liver. Thirteen (48%) of tumors extended beyond the organ of origin: four invaded neighboring organs and/or regional nodes and nine involved distant metastases. The 3-year event-free survival (EFS) for those with localized disease was superior to those with metastatic disease (66.6% 95% CI 5-95% vs 33% 95% CI 5-68%, respectively; P = .005). A complete resection was feasible in 17 patients. The 3-year EFS in these patients was superior to those with no or incomplete resection (R0 vs R1/R2, respectively; P = .007). Overall, 16 children had no evidence of disease at follow-up, and one is alive with disease; five died, and five were lost to follow-up. CONCLUSIONS: Data from our experience demonstrated a wide heterogeneity of presentation and outcome of these tumors. Localized disease and complete surgical resection were the main prognostic factors of good outcome. Other therapies may have a role in prolonging survival in metastatic disease.

ABSTRACT

PURPOSE: To evaluate clinical features at diagnosis, prognostic factors, and outcomes of malignant sacrococcygeal germ cell tumors (SC-GCTs) in patients enrolled in the Associazione Italiana Ematologia Oncologia Pediatrica (AIEOP) TCG 2004 protocol. PATIENTS AND METHODS: A prospective analysis was conducted on all consecutive patients diagnosed with malignant SC-GCTs between January 2004 and May 2017. Patients with stage I underwent surgery and subsequent surveillance, the others received pediatric cisplatinum-etoposide-bleomycin (pPEB) regimen and eventual deferred surgery. RESULTS: Of 45 patients, 35 were females. Age at diagnosis ranged from 1 day to 3.6 years (median 1.6 years); 26 were stage IV. Of 38 patients who underwent surgery, pathology revealed yolk sac tumor (YST) in 27 and teratoma + YST/embryonal carcinoma in 11, while seven patients were diagnosed based on imaging and elevated levels of alpha-fetoprotein (AFP). Of six patients approached with surgery, only one relapsed and was rescued with first-line chemotherapy. Overall, 38 out of 45 achieved complete remission, three a partial remission, and four were resistant. Ten out of 41 patients who entered remission later relapsed and nine were rescued with a second-line treatment. We observed a global failure percentage of 31% and a 5-year overall survival (OS) and event-free survival (EFS) of 95% and 69%, respectively. CONCLUSIONS: Chemotherapyis generally effective in malignant SC-GCTs, even though almost one-third of our patients experienced events salvageable with second-line treatment. Most of the relapses occurred within 1 year from diagnosis. A close follow up with serial AFP level monitoring should be done for at least 2 years after diagnosis.

ABSTRACT

Extraperitoneal approach is sometimes recommended for kidney transplantation (KT) in children weighting <15 kg. We hypothesized that this approach might be as successful as in patients with normal weight. Data of all consecutive KTs performed between 2013 and 2019 were retrospectively reviewed. Early outcomes and surgical complications were compared between children weighing ≤15 kg (low-weight (LW) group) and those weighing >15 kg (Normal-weight (NW) group). All the 108 KTs were performed through an extraperitoneal approach. The LW group included 31 patients (mean age 3.5 ± 1.4 years), whose mean weight was 11.1 ± 2.0 kg. In the LW group,-a primary graft nonfunction (PNGF) occurred in one patient (3.2%), surgical complications occurred in nine (29%), with four venous thrombosis. In the NW group, PNGF occurred in one case (1.3%), delayed graft function (DGF) in eight (10%), surgical complications in 11 (14%) with only one case of venous thrombosis. In both groups, no need for patch during wound closure and no wound dehiscence were reported. The extraperitoneal approach can be effectively used in LW children. No differences were observed in the overall complication rate (P = 0.10), except for the occurrence of venous thrombosis (P = 0.02). This might be related to patients' characteristics of the LW group.

ABSTRACT

Pancreatoblastoma (PB) is a tumor typically seen in childhood. Despite its rarity, there are some internationally agreed recommendations for its first-line treatment, but very little is known about the management of relapse. We reviewed the literature on the treatment and outcome of children with progressing/recurrent PB, and the role of high-dose chemotherapy (HD-CT) or liver transplantation in difficult cases. A first analysis concerned 15 patients: liver metastases were the most frequent cause of first-line treatment failure. Eight patients underwent surgery, only 3 were irradiated. Various second-line chemotherapy regimens were adopted, with evidence of response in 8 children. The most often-used combinations included etoposide, cyclophosphamide/ifosfamide, and cisplatin/carboplatin. Overall, 7 patients are alive with a median follow-up of 24 months (range, 3 to 88 mo). In a separate analysis, considering patients in first-line or second-line treatment, we found 5 of 6 patients alive after HD-CT and 3 of 3 after liver transplantation. Our review shows that the outcome for patients with recurrent PB is not always dismal, especially when surgery is possible. Different chemotherapy combinations can be used, and HD-CT or liver transplantation may be considered in selected cases.

ABSTRACT

INTRODUCTION: Mixed total anomalous pulmonary venous connection (TAPVC) is a extremely rare congenital heart disease. METHODS: We report the initial management of a case of Mixed total anomalous pulmonary venous connection associated to right extralobar bronchopulmonary sequestration (BPS). RESULTS: Mixed TAPVC associated to right extra-lobar BPS was diagnosed at birth in a full-term newborn. At one month of age, the patient underwent embolization of the BPS, complicated by coil entrapment in the right common iliac artery requiring urgent laparotomy. Few days later, the congenital cardiac repair was accomplished uneventfully. At 12-months follow-up, the patient did not have pulmonary hypertension, but presented a moderate stenosis of the right femoral artery, which was effectively treated with anticoagulation therapy. CONCLUSIONS: The multidisciplinary approach allowed a successful treatment of these complex anomalies and the related potential complications.

ABSTRACT

PURPOSE: To clarify the role of primary tumor resection in stage 4S neuroblastoma. METHODS: We investigated a cohort of 172 infants diagnosed with stage 4S neuroblastoma between 1994 and 2013. Of 160 evaluable patients, 62 underwent upfront resection of the primary tumor and 98 did not. RESULTS: Five-year progression-free and overall survival were significantly better in those who had undergone upfront surgery (83.6% vs 64.2% and 96.8% vs 85.7%, respectively). One post-operative death and four non-fatal complications occurred in the resection group. Three patients who had not undergone resection died of chemotherapy-related toxicity. Thirteen patients underwent late surgery to remove a residual tumor, without complications: all but one alive. Outcomes were better in patients diagnosed from 2000 onwards. CONCLUSION: Infants diagnosed with stage 4S neuroblastoma who underwent upfront tumor resection had a better outcome. However, this result cannot be definitely attributed to surgery, since these patients were selected on the basis of their favorable presenting features. Although the question of whether to operate or not at disease onset is still unsolved, this study confirms the importance of obtaining enough adequate tumor tissue to enable histological and biological studies to properly address treatment, to achieve the best possible outcome.

ABSTRACT

BACKGROUND: Pheochromocytomas (PCs) are neuroendocrine tumors arising from the chromaffin cells of the adrenal gland, and paragangliomas (PGLs) are their extra-adrenal counterparts arising from ganglia along the sympathetic/parasympathetic chain. Surgery is the cornerstone of treatment. A sporatic or inherited germline mutation is commonly associated. MATERIALS AND METHODS: Among over 1000 patients registered into the Tumori Rari in Età Pediatrica-rare tumors in pediatric age project-from 2000 to 2019, 50 were affected by PC/PGL. All clinical and therapeutic data were evaluated. RESULTS: Twenty-eight patients had PC and 22 had PGL. Age at diagnosis ranged between 5 and 17 years. Thirty-five patients had symptoms related to catecholamine hypersecretion; in 7 of 50 patients, diagnosis was incidental or done during assessment of a familial syndrome. In all cases, conventional imaging was effective to assess the presence of a tumor. In addition, 18 of 38 functional imaging studies were positive (61%). Forty-eight patients were eligible for surgery: a complete resection was more frequently achieved in PC than in PGL (26/28 vs 11/22). All relapses were treated with surgery alone, surgery plus medical treatment, or chemotherapy alone; one PC with metastasis at diagnosis received radiotherapy only. Forty-four patients were in the first, second, or third complete remission (10/50 recurred; 8/10 carried a germline mutation). Five of 50 patients were alive with disease. One patient died of disease. CONCLUSIONS: Surgery can be curative in most tumors but it may not be always effective in removing PGLs. Severe postsurgical sequelae may affect these patients. Genetic tests should always be considered in individuals affected, and genetic counseling should be offered to their families.

ABSTRACT

BACKGROUND: Malignant germ cell tumors (GCTs) are a heterogeneous group of rare neoplasms in children. Optimal outcome is achieved with multimodal therapies for patients with both localized and advanced disease, especially after the introduction of platinum-based chemotherapy regimens. In this respect, data on salvage treatment for children with relapsed or platinum-refractory disease are still limited. METHODS: Retrospective analysis of data regarding patients affected by malignant GCTs with platinum-refractory or relapsed disease after first-line treatment according to AIEOP TCGM 2004 protocol was conducted. RESULTS: Twenty-one patients, 15 females and 6 males, were considered for the analysis. All 21 patients received second-line conventional chemotherapy (SLCT), two of these immediately after surgery for local relapse removal. Two patients showed a progression of disease during SLCT and died of disease shortly thereafter, whereas 19 patients were in partial remission (PR) or complete remission (CR) after SLCT. Treatment after SLCT consisted in surgery on residual tumor mass (9/19) followed by high dose of chemotherapy (HDCT) with autologous hematopoietic stem cell support (16/19). The overall survival (OS) and event-free survival of the whole populations are 71% and 66.6%, respectively. Platinum-refractory patients OS is 54.5% compared with 91.5% of the relapsed group. There were no treatment-related deaths. CONCLUSION: SLCT followed or not by HDCT is an effective salvage treatment for children with relapsed/refractory GCTs. However, the role of HDCT following SLCT needs to be further investigated, especially regarding the identification of specific patient subgroups, which can benefit from this more intensive treatment.

ABSTRACT

PURPOSE: The presence of pleural effusion or ascites at the time of diagnosis is generally considered a poor prognostic factor for children with rhabdomyosarcoma (RMS), and treatment is usually intensified despite the fact that there are no published studies to support this decision. We investigated the prognostic role of the presence of pleural effusion or ascites at diagnosis in patients with localized RMS consecutively enrolled in the Italian Soft Tissue Sarcoma Committee protocols over a 30-year period. METHODS: We reviewed the radiological reports at diagnosis of 150 children with supradiaphragmatic and infradiaphragmatic RMS, noting any presence of effusion and its extent (minimal, moderate, or massive). All patients received intensive chemotherapy, surgery, and standard or hyperfractionated radiotherapy. RESULTS: Effusion was identified in 32 children (21.3%), 14 with pleural effusion and 18 with ascites. As for its extent, 13 children presented with minimal, 12 with moderate, and 7 with massive effusion. The 5-year progression-free survival (PFS) rate was 49.8% (confidence interval [CI] 31.7-65.5) and 49.5% (CI 40-58.2) for patients with and without effusion, respectively (P = .5). When only patients with moderate or massive effusion were considered, however, their PFS was 36.8% (CI 16.5-57.5) versus 51.2% (CI 42.2-59.5) in patients with minimal or no effusion (P = .01). On the whole, patients with pleural effusion had a very poor outcome with a 5-year PFS of 35.7% (CI 13-59.4). CONCLUSIONS: The presence of moderate or massive effusion seems to be an unfavorable prognostic factor in children with RMS, and justifies their inclusion in experimental studies.

ABSTRACT

BACKGROUND: Solid pseudopapillary pancreatic tumors (SPPT) are an extremely rare entity in pediatric patients. Even if the role of radical surgical resection as primary treatment is well established, data about follow-up after pancreatic resection in children are scant. METHODS: A retrospective review of data from the Italian Pediatric Rare Tumor Registry (TREP) was performed. Short-term (<30 days) and long-term complications of different surgical resections, as well as long-term follow-up were evaluated. RESULTS: From January 2000 to present, 43 patients (male:female = 8:35) were enrolled. The median age at diagnosis was 13.2 years (range, 7-18). Nine children had an incidental diagnosis, whereas 26 complained of abdominal pain and 4 of palpable mass. Tumors arose either from the head of pancreas (n = 14) or from body/tail (n = 29): only one patient presented with metastatic disease. Resection was complete in all patients (cephalic duodenopancreatectomy vs distal resection). At follow-up (median, 8.4 years; range, 0-17 years), one recurrence occurred in a patient with intraoperative rupture. All patients are alive. Three pancreatic fistulas occurred in the body/tail group, whereas four complications occurred in the head group (one ileal ischemia, two stenosis of the pancreatic duct, and one chylous fistula). CONCLUSION: Surgery is the best therapeutic option for these tumors; hence, complete resection is mandatory. Extensive resections, including cephalic duodenopancreatectomy, are safe when performed in specialized centers. Long-term follow-up should be aimed to detect tumor recurrence and to evaluate residual pancreatic function.
